Imagine replacing detail with the most common thing that mostly fits. Take a picture of a sculpture with a cool texture? Sorry, that’s incredibly hard to specify, but it’s marble so the AI knows to redraw it as a (smooth) marble statue.
Take a picture of your partner’s eyes? Geez, do you know how complex eyes are? Look, I’m not unreasonable, the eyes are sea green in high detail with flecks of brown and a slight shimmer in the bottom right corner. Now you can have a nice compact image of your partner.
Imagine a social media where images look weird and inconsistent unless they conform to conditions that don’t produce hallucinations. Expected textures, expected lighting conditions, expected locations, expected hairstyles and expected facial features.
And yes, I do know AI sharpening is already deployed. Every time I zoom in on pictures I took with my phone I feel grossed out by the hallucinatory soup.
